SQLinfo.ru - Все о MySQL

Форум пользователей MySQL

Задавайте вопросы, мы ответим

Вы не зашли.

#1 12.07.2011 12:48:07

Veelena
Участник
Зарегистрирован: 12.07.2011
Сообщений: 3

Как сделать аудит на таблицу

Добрый день. Проблема такая, сервер MySQL версии 4.1.22.
Я работаю только с MS SQL  там есть реализация триггеров.
В инете прочитала что mysql поддерживает триггеры только с версии 5.2
Надо сделать аудит на одну таблицу, как это можно осуществить средствами mysql.?

Неактивен

 

#2 12.07.2011 14:30:41

LazY
_cмельчак
MySQL Authorized Developer and DBA
Зарегистрирован: 02.04.2007
Сообщений: 849

Re: Как сделать аудит на таблицу

MySQL поддерживает триггеры с версии 5.0.

Что подразумевается под аудитом на таблицу?

Неактивен

 

#3 13.07.2011 05:40:02

Veelena
Участник
Зарегистрирован: 12.07.2011
Сообщений: 3

Re: Как сделать аудит на таблицу

Если удаляются записи из таблицы, надо копировать их в другую таблицу

Неактивен

 

#4 13.07.2011 16:14:31

LazY
_cмельчак
MySQL Authorized Developer and DBA
Зарегистрирован: 02.04.2007
Сообщений: 849

Re: Как сделать аудит на таблицу

Да, так можно.
Нужен триггер BEFORE DELETE.

Неактивен

 

#5 14.07.2011 06:26:08

Veelena
Участник
Зарегистрирован: 12.07.2011
Сообщений: 3

Re: Как сделать аудит на таблицу

а можно поподробнее, куда этот триггрер писать. В mssql все просто, по табличке тыкаешь и пишешь триггер, а тут ничего нету такого, ну или я найти не могу. Подскажите куда именно "тыкнуть" надо? ))

Неактивен

 

Board footer

Работает на PunBB
© Copyright 2002–2008 Rickard Andersson